Handover — Splitglass diff viewer

Large-file mode now chunks at render time; plugins get windows, not full buffers. Syntax pass is lazy, so don't assume tokens exist past the viewport. Marek's streaming patch is merged. Plugin authors should test against the big-file fixtures. The defaults the viewer ships with are these.

config for kafof-bawef:
holath:
  log_level: debug
  metrics_host: metrics.holath.qorvelsys.internal
  pin: 2191
  pool_size: 32

// Notes for the weekly eng sync re: Gallerywhisper, our museum audio-guide app.
// This constant sets the prefetch radius for exhibit audio clips. At the
// Hollen Pavilion pilot we learned visitors walk faster than our original
// estimate, so clips were buffering mid-stride. Bumping this to three rooms
// ahead fixed it, at a modest bandwidth cost. Don't lower it without testing
// on the slow gallery wifi first — seriously, it's painful. The trace token
// from the pilot build that validated this number is appended just below.

trace token, kahap-bagaf: htk4_8458

Nice work ripping out the old Quillbox job queue — that thing was held together with duct tape and optimism. Swapping to Lattice workers simplifies retries a lot, and the release notes for Drift 4.2 should call that out. One ask before we merge: double-check the worker counts against staging load. The tuning constants we settled on are below.

constants for fajop-tahaf:
RATE_LIMITS = {
    "holael": 2,
    "oliael": 10,
    "druael": 10,
    "wenwyn": 10,
}

Ticket: Holiday opening hours — Brindle House. Over the closure week (23–31 Dec) the building opens 09:00–15:00 only. New starters: reception is unstaffed, so collect your badge in advance from the Level 2 facilities office. If your badge isn't active yet, the side entrance accepts the temporary code below.

staff pass of haduf-yagaf = bdg-DBSQF-1